British Indian Ocean Territory address format

British Indian Ocean Territory addresses normally include street address, city or locality, and postal code. For international mail, put BRITISH INDIAN OCEAN TERRITORY on the final line.

Quick answer

How to write an address for British Indian Ocean Territory

To write an address for British Indian Ocean Territory, use this order: addressee, organisation, street address, city or locality, postal code, and country.

  1. AddresseeRecipient name, if you are writing a postal address.
  2. OrganisationCompany, department, hotel, or building name when useful.
  3. Street addressStreet address, building number, unit, floor, or delivery line.
  4. City or localityCity, town, locality, or postal town.
  5. Postal codePostal code, such as BBND 1ZZ.
  6. CountryUse BRITISH INDIAN OCEAN TERRITORY for international mail.
Example address format
1 Example Street
Example City
BBND 1ZZ
BRITISH INDIAN OCEAN TERRITORY

Postal codes

British Indian Ocean Territory postal code format.

British Indian Ocean Territory postal code examples include BBND 1ZZ.

Common mistakes

What to check before validation.

  • Using a postal code that does not match examples such as BBND 1ZZ.
  • Mixing address parts into one unstructured CSV field.
  • Leaving off the country line for international shipping.
  • Treating formatting as proof that the address is real or deliverable.
